Table 2.
Differences in ferritin induction among three types of HOS cells
Cell type | Time (h) | Dose of iron (µM) | ||
---|---|---|---|---|
0 | 75 | 300 | ||
HOS | 6 | 6.69 ± 0.69c | 29.74 ± 1.07a,c | 34.95 ± 3.25a,c |
18 | 6.57 ± 0.15c | 289.77 ± 50.69a,b,c | 175.11 ± 34.42a,b,c | |
As-8w-HOS | 6 | 2.52 ± 0.20 | 5.20 ± 0.67a | 5.61 ± 0.58a |
18 | 2.18 ± 0.08 | 7.46 ± 0.53a | 6.64 ± 0.40a | |
As-T-HOS | 6 | 1.05 ± 0.53 | 0.87 ± 0.44 | 0.77 ± 0.47 |
18 | 0.82 ± 0.43 | 0.92 ± 0.46 | 1.25 ± 0.65 |
Parental HOS cells, As-8w-HOS, and As-T-HOS cells were treated with different concentrations of FAC in serum-free media. Cells were lysed in RIPA buffer and ferritin was measured by ELISA. Results are presented as the means ± SE from three independent experiments and shown as ng ferritin per mg protein.
Significantly different from control HOS cells (P < 0.05).
Significantly different from 6-h iron treatment (P < 0.05).
Significantly different from the As-8w-HOS and As-T-HOS cells under the same experimental conditions (P < 0.05).
